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28696050 70 1765930 11310037
520811576 71
520811576 71
65601 235 218635
All about undefined
Interested in learning more?
520811576 71
65601 235 218635
See more
58856 37
31382475 11411 7816 3240
See more
7367549 338 65484055935
9779 37 99367756448 788
See more